Top 7 Hardest Shots In EPL History: Ex-Newcastle Star Obafemi Martins, Beckham Make List
Published: February 06, 2018
Nigeria international Obafemi Martins has been included in the list of players with the top seven hardest shots in the history of the Premier League by British newspaper The Sun.
The former Newcastle United striker finished in sixth position ahead of Manchester United legend David Beckham's effort against Derby County on September 4, 1996.
Martins's thunderbolt against Tottenham Hotspur on January 14, 2007 was recorded at 84mph, which is four miles less than the maximum speed of a Spur-winged goose.
The former Inter Milan, Wolfsburg and Levante star scored 35 goals in 104 appearances during his three-year stay at St James Park and had a brief loan spell at Birmingham City in 2011.
David Beckham's shot against Chelsea took the number one spot on the list, it was timed at 97.9mph.
Top Seven Hardest Shots In Premier League History
1)David Beckham v Chelsea (August 17 1996) - 97.9mph
2)Ritchie Humphreys v Aston Villa (August 17 1996) - 95.9mph
3)Matt Le Tissier v Newcastle (January 18 1997) - 86.6mph
4)Alan Shearer v Leicester (February 2 1997) - 85.8mph
5)Tugay v Southampton (November 3, 2001) - 84.2mph
6)Obafemi Martins v Tottenham (January 14, 2007) - 84mph
7)David Beckham v Derby (September 4, 1996) - 80.5mph.
